Namhai-gun, Gyeongnam Province, announced on the 1st that Lee Hyung-mo (75) won the silver prize in the "Senior Category 1" at the '2023 National Happiness IT Competition' hosted by the Ministry of Science and ICT.

The National Happiness IT Competition is a contest for information-vulnerable groups such as the elderly, middle-aged, and marriage immigrants. It is hosted by the Ministry of Science and ICT and organized by the National Information Society Agency and metropolitan local governments, with regional preliminaries and a national competition held.

Lee, who won the silver prize in the Senior Category 1, has honed his skills by participating in Namhae-gun's free citizen informatization education and is currently working as a senior IT instructor for the Computer Volunteer Association.


An award ceremony was held at Namhae-gun Office on October 31st.


At the event, County Governor Jang Chung-nam said, "You have personally demonstrated the truth that there is no age limit to learning, and this is a great result that confirms the qualitative improvement of Namhae-gun's citizen informatization education," adding, "We will continue to provide digital learning opportunities to enhance the IT utilization capabilities of our citizens."



The free citizen informatization education promoted by Namhae-gun is conducted at the Comprehensive Social Welfare Center's computer training room and the town and township information use centers. As of the end of September this year, 77 courses have been offered with 841 participants.
